JoshF Posted March 26, 2009 Share Posted March 26, 2009 (edited) I'm currently running a 14 ISMI Recoil w/17lb ISMI Main Spring. I've played around quite a bit shuffling between the 12.5 & 14 ISMI. The 14 seams "soft and bouncy" while the 12.5 is "quick/harsh and flat". I use to run a 12lb Wolff and it seemed the best of both worlds. So am I just dreaming this up or has anyone else noticed a distinct difference in the recoil impulse/sight tracking between similar weight Wolff and ISMI springs? OH, and I run a full dustcover & lightened slide Edited March 26, 2009 by JoshF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
